题目内容
(请给出正确答案)
[主观题]
(对象串行化)对象串行化时会将类的静态变量一同串行化。
提问人:网友libinbin
发布时间:2022-01-07
A.可串行化的类必须实现Serializable接口
B.可串行化的类中的静态变量可以不被串行化
C.private数据访问权限能够限制数据不被串行化
D.对象串行化使用Java语言提供的默认机制
A、串行化对象可以把一个对象转换成字节流,也可以把字节流反串行化为原始对象的拷贝
B、对象串行化时是将对象成员变量的值进行串行化
C、对象串行化时会将成员方法和类的静态变量一同串行化
D、对象串行化时要实现Serializable 接口
A、Ⅱ、Ⅲ
B、Ⅱ、Ⅳ
C、Ⅰ、Ⅱ、Ⅲ
D、Ⅰ、Ⅱ、Ⅳ
A、序列化是为了把对象序列化成字节流写入到磁盘中,去序列化是从文件中读取的过程。
B、类的所有成员都可以被序列化。
C、BinaryFormatter方法需要引入命名空间using System.Runtime.Serialization.Formatters.Binary;
D、在使用序列化方法时,需要在该类声明前加入[Serializable]。生成该类的对象后,Serialize和Deserialize分别将对象写入流和从流中读取对象。
A、用ObjectOutputStream的write()方法
B、用DataStream的writeObject()方法
C、用ObjectOutputStream的writeObject()方法
D、用FileOutputStream的writeObject()方法
为了保护您的账号安全,请在“简答题”公众号进行验证,点击“官网服务”-“账号验证”后输入验证码“”完成验证,验证成功后方可继续查看答案!